For my podcast, I wanted to share the story of one of my closest mentors. Entrepreneurship has always been something that intrigued me, but I‘ve never had the guts to do it. So for my podcast, I decided to set up a zoom call with Casey Bonner, the owner, and creator of CBThreads. I talked with Casey about the process of creating something out of nothing, how to come from a small town, and be successful.
So we chatted on zoom, for about 2 hours but I cut down to the best most important tips and info that Casey provided, reduced the background noise and awkward zoom glitches to compose this podcast. After that, I added in some copyright free music and created the logo for the cover and there was my finished podcast.
Going through this process has taught me to pay attention to the small details of an audio track and to use Audition to remove those noises. I have also learned just how often we as speakers use filler words and after listening back to the Zoom recording audio is can be very distracting if I hadn’t removed the ‘Ums’ and ‘Likes.’
